Investigating Volvo VECU Diagnostics: Solutions

When it comes to handling issues with a Volvo's Vehicle Electronic Control Unit (VECU), having the right troubleshooting tools and knowledge is crucial. The VECU plays a vital role in controlling numerous automobile functions, so any malfunction can have a major impact on performance and safety. Fortunately, there are various methods to diagnose VECU problems.

  • Begin by examining the vehicle's alert lights. A glowing check engine light can often indicate a VECU issue.
  • Consult the vehicle's owner's manual for detailed information about likely VECU problems and their fixes.
  • Employ a reputable OBD-II scanner to retrieve diagnostic messages stored in the VECU's memory. These codes can provide crucial information about the nature of the issue.

Remember attempting to fix a VECU issue without proper training and expertise can potentially compound the difficulty. Seek a qualified Volvo mechanic for assistance in pinpointing and fixing VECU problems.
